If Shabazz was riding high off their 10-0 takedown of Tech last Thursday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Shabazz Bulldogs lost 13-3 to the Newark Academy Minutemen on Monday. The loss continues a trend for Shabazz in their matchups with Newark Academy: they've now lost four in a row.
For Newark Academy's part, they got a great performance from Shane Sampson as he struck out nine batters over five inn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off two hits.
On the hitting side, Jared Levine and Jack DiVirgillio did most of the damage at the plate: Levine scored four runs and stole five bases while getting on base in all four of his plate appearances, while DiVirgillio scored three runs and stole three bases while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Caleb Epstein was another key contributor, scoring two runs and stealing a base while getting on base in all three of his plate appearances.
Shabazz's defeat dropped their record down to 1-14. As for Newark Academy, the victory (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 15-6.
